Special Track on Cloud Technologies in Simulation Applications

Existing simulation application providers aim to provide a wide range of functions while guaranteeing promised performance such as reliability, availability, and security. To provide personalized simulation services to users, a great amount of simulation applications are created, transferred and processed by a lot of distributed servers and devices. This brings several big challenges including managing computational infrastructure and communication services, analyzing data for personalized service recommendation. As a new paradigm, cloud computing can provide on-demand and flexible processing for a huge amount of simulation applications, and provisioning of resources based on Internet technologies. The flexibility of infrastructure in cloud computing provides the desired performance (e.g., reliability and scalability) for simulation application providers. Cloud-based methods pertain to many different aspects for existing simulation application providers, and can increase their applications in modern industrial enterprises.
This special session is a place where researchers and practitioners share ideas on the methodologies and the applications of cloud technologies in simulation applications. Our interested topics are enumerated in the below, yet submissions in the relevant fields are welcome.
